Proposed H.B. No. 5485
Session Year 2023
 


AN ACT CONCERNING A COST-BENEFIT ANALYSIS OF ESTABLISHING A HUSKY FOR ALL, UNIVERSAL HEALTH CARE FINANCING SYSTEM.

To require a study of the costs and benefits of transitioning from the current health care system in the state to a universal, single payer health care system.
